简介:本文将详细解析Hadoop分布式文件系统中NameNode的启动过程,包括其核心功能、启动步骤以及常见问题与解决方法,帮助读者更好地理解和应用Hadoop。
Hadoop是一个开源的分布式计算框架,广泛应用于大数据处理和分析领域。在Hadoop生态系统中,NameNode扮演着至关重要的角色,它是Hadoop分布式文件系统(HDFS)的元数据服务器,负责维护文件系统的目录树、文件块与数据节点之间的映射关系等关键信息。
NameNode主要承担以下功能:
启动NameNode通常需要执行以下步骤:
hdfs namenode -format命令来格式化HDFS文件系统,生成必要的元数据文件和目录。hadoop-daemon.sh start namenode命令启动NameNode服务。在启动过程中,NameNode会加载元数据信息,并监听客户端请求。在启动NameNode时,可能会遇到一些常见问题,下面列举几个典型的例子及其解决方法:
jps命令查看NameNode进程是否在运行,使用netstat命令检查端口是否开放。为了确保NameNode的稳定运行,以下是一些实践建议:
本文详细解析了Hadoop NameNode的启动过程,包括其功能、启动步骤以及常见问题与解决方法。通过本文的学习,读者可以更好地理解和应用Hadoop分布式文件系统,提高大数据处理和分析的能力。同时,也提供了一些实践建议,帮助读者在实际应用中更好地管理和维护Hadoop集群。